美文网首页
Git 代码回滚到没有Push的版本

Git 代码回滚到没有Push的版本

作者: 整个夏天 | 来源:发表于2019-06-19 10:33 被阅读0次

因为需求变动删了一些代码,所以要查询上个版本的一个接口,于是强行回滚了代码,但是本地有4个commit还没push,瞬间炸啦,~6天的代码没有了......

因为一直都是用的sourceTree的界面图片操作,所以只会显示git log的信息,对于没有push的不会展示

第二天找了这方面的资料,因为似乎以前听过git是可以找回任何一个commit的记录,于是找到了git reflog这个命令,可以显示出git log没有的一些删除覆盖记录,最后代码顺利找回,后面还是要有个好的习惯,多commit 、多push

大结局.png

相关文章

  • Git 代码回滚到没有Push的版本

    因为需求变动删了一些代码,所以要查询上个版本的一个接口,于是强行回滚了代码,但是本地有4个commit还没push...

  • Git远程代码回滚

    1、本地回滚到指定版本 2、推到回滚的代码到远程仓库 git push -f 可能出现强制push没权限image...

  • git回滚版本

    回滚到指定版本idgit reset --hard commit_id强推回滚到远程git push -f ori...

  • git常用操作

    git回滚到任意版本 git回滚到任意版本 先显示提交的log 回滚到指定的版本 强制提交 完美

  • GIT 常用命令随笔

    常用git 命令 git 代码回滚 先显示提交的log 回滚到指定的版本 强制提交 git 新建项目 git 修改...

  • 2018-11-22

    GitLab代码回滚到特定版本——本地+远程 在当前branch上多次commit代码并且push后,发现不符合要...

  • git回滚

    一、 git回滚到任意版本 查看历史提交的log中的版本号$ git log -3 查看最近3次提交记录 回滚到...

  • 2018-07-03

    git版本怎么删除远程分支 1. 首先把本地代码回滚到你想要的地方 git reset --hard commit...

  • 开发常用命令

    Maven 检查mvn包依赖mvn dependency:tree Git 强制文件回滚到某个版本git chec...

  • git--step by step

    刚创建的github版本库,在push代码时出错: $ git push -u origin master To ...

网友评论

      本文标题:Git 代码回滚到没有Push的版本

      本文链接:https://www.haomeiwen.com/subject/cdrhqctx.html